区块链的魅力在哪里?
谈到区块链,很多人会想起比特币,或者以太坊这样的数字货币。但其实,区块链远不止于此。它的应用可以说是无处不在,从金融到物流,再到医疗,甚至政府的透明度都能提升。那到底怎么才能让广大开发者都能参与到这个革命性的技术中呢?今天就聊聊怎么搭建一个区块链源码平台,让更多人能对这个领域产生兴趣。
确定你的平台定位
在你开始写代码之前,先想清楚你希望你的平台能干什么。是提供一个简单的开发框架?还是一个完整的生态系统?或者是一个开放的社区,让各路开发者都能在这里交流?像我身边的一些朋友,他们在搭建的时候,最开始就是因为找不到合适的资源,所以索性自己动手。现在,他们的平台已吸引了不少小团队来这里尝试开发。
选择合适的技术栈
这里就要聊聊技术了。选择合适的技术栈很关键,举个例子,如果你对C 比较熟悉,可以考虑用它来开发底层库,这样可以保证性能;如果想快速开发,可以关注Python,简洁又易于上手。上个月,我碰到一个同学,他用Node.js搭建了一个简单的区块链项目,真心觉得现在的工具越来越方便,学习门槛也是越来越低。
寻找开源项目作为参考
开源社区有无数优秀的项目可以作为借鉴。像GitHub上面的区块链项目就很丰富,看看别的项目如何处理数据存储、网络通讯等问题,会让你的思路开阔不少。之前我有一个朋友,他用Ethereum的代码作为基础,修改后实现了一个小型的投票系统。结果得到了很多反馈,大家都感觉这个应用很有意思。
设计友好的用户界面
无论你的后台多么强大,如果没有一个友好的用户界面,用户也不会愿意使用。想想你第一次接触复杂的区块链钱包时的感受,肯定感觉各种繁琐。为了避免这种情况,可以请一些UI设计师来帮忙,或者参考一些成熟的项目,抓住用户的痛点,让用户能容易上手。
搭建社区和生态
这样的一个平台,绝离不开社区的支持。可以开个论坛或者微信群,让大家可以随时交流。像我有个朋友,他搭建的区块链平台在刚开始的时候,只有他一个人,但他保持着和用户的沟通。现在,他的社区用户已经超过了千人,形成了良好的开发氛围。
不断更新迭代
区块链技术瞬息万变,所以定期更新是必须的。听取开发者的反馈,按照大家的需求进行迭代,才能保持平台的活力。一个朋友告诉我,他会定期举行线上分享会,讨论使用体验,刚开始的时候,反馈并不多,但慢慢大家都愿意开口了,改进意见也越来越多。
警惕安全隐患
安全性始终是区块链的重中之重。无论你是开发者还是使用者,都需要对安全问题保持高度警惕。我在某个项目中,曾见过不少因为代码疏漏导致的安全漏洞,最终损失惨重。建议在平台中加入一些测试工具,定期进行代码审计,确保每个功能都安全可靠。
与行业保持联系
即便是自己搭建了一个平台,也不能把自己封闭在一个小圈子里。参与行业会议、展览,保持与行业内的人士联系,会让你的视野更广阔。上个月我参加了一场区块链大会,收获颇丰,结识不少志同道合的朋友,也有不少陌生人对我的项目表现出浓厚的兴趣,这种机会非常难得。
走向未来
区块链技术会在未来的某一天,成为社会的基础架构之一。你搭建的源码平台,可能在某一时刻就会被赋予更多的使命。所以一定要保持初心,持续推动技术的普及,也许就在某个节点上,你的努力会改变很多人的生活。
建立一个区块链源码平台,虽然会面临很多挑战,但只要我们坚持下去,相信一定能让更多人受益。希望这篇文章能给你带来灵感,也许你就是下一个改变世界的人!
